Abstract Geothermal energy in the territory of the Slovak Republic is related to geothermal waters which largely over in Triassiv carbonates of Inner Western Varpathian nappes and, to a lesser extent in Neogene sand, sandstones and conglomerates or in Neogene andesites and related pyroclastics. The distribution of aquifers with geothermal waters and the thermal manifestation of hydrogeothermal structures have enabled the definition of 26 prospective areas and structures with potentially exploitable geothermal energy resources. These aquifers lie at depth of 200-500 m (except in spring areas) and the reservoir temperatures of their geothermal waters range from 20-240oC. The total amount of thermal energy potential of geothermal waters in prospective areas represents 5538 MWt.
